Greetings

Hello
cześć   
Halo   

Thank You
dziękuję   
Nuhun   

How Are You?
Jak się masz?   
Kumaha kabarna?   

Good Night
dobranoc   
Wilujeng kulem   

Good Evening
dobry wieczór   
Wilujeng wengi   

Good Afternoon
dzień dobry   
Wilujeng siang   

Good Morning
Dzień dobry   
Wilujeng énjing   

Please
proszę   
Mangga   

Sorry
Przepraszam   
Hapunten   

Bye
do widzenia   
Wilujeng angkat   

I Love You
kocham Cię   
Abdi bogoh ka anjeun   

Excuse Me
przepraszam   
Punten

Please in Polish and Sundanese

When you want to request someone for something then it is necessary to say please. But if you don't know how to say please in Polish and Sundanese then it disappointing. So, Polish Greetings vs Sundanese greetings helps us to learn please in Polish and Sundanese language.

  • Please in Polish : proszę.
  • Please in Sundanese : Mangga.

In some situations, if you need to apologize then Polish greetings vs Sundanese greetings provides to say sorry in Polish and Sundanese language.

  • Sorry in Polish : Przepraszam.
  • Sorry in Sundanese : Hapunten.

How are you in Polish and Sundanese

After you say hello to someone then you will want to ask how are you? And if you wish to know what's how are you in Polish and Sundanese then Polish greetings vs Sundanese greetings helps you.

  • How are you in Polish is Jak się masz?.
  • How are you in Sundanese is Kumaha kabarna?.

Other Polish and Sundanese Greetings

Are you finding few more Polish greetings vs Sundanese greetings? So let's compare other Polish and Sundanese greetings.

  • Good Morning in Polish is Dzień dobry.
  • Good Night in Polish is dobranoc.
  • Good Morning in Sundanese is Wilujeng énjing.
  • Good Night in Sundanese is Wilujeng kulem.
